Highlights
Are people in Clovis older or younger than people in Elk City?
- The Median Age in Clovis is 2.9 years younger than in Elk City.

Are housing costs cheaper in Clovis or Elk City?
- Clovis housing costs are 1.0% less expensive than Elk City hous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Clovis or Elk City?
- The average commute for residents of Clovis is 1.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Elk City.

Things to do in Elk City?
Elk City, OK is located in Beckham County on Interstate 40 near Sayre. With a population of more than 12,000 people it's one of Oklahoma's largest cities and has many recreational activities available like fishing at nearby Foss Lake or visiting Wildhorse State Park for hiking or camping adventures.

Things to do in Clovis?
Clovis, New Mexico is located in Curry County providing residents entertainment options from exploring the Blackwater Draw Site to swimming at Hillcrest Park Pool & Water Slide combined with shops like Yucca Shopping Center and job prospects through Plains Regional Medical Center
